Low Maintenance and Resilience

effortless strength and durability

For those seeking a hassle-free addition to their indoor garden, low maintenance and resilience make cacti an ideal choice.

These hardy plants thrive in a variety of conditions, allowing you to focus your energy on nurturing other aspects of your home. You won't need to worry about frequent watering or complicated care routines. Cacti typically require watering only every few weeks, and their ability to store moisture means they're forgiving if you occasionally forget.

Their resilience extends beyond just water needs. Cacti are adaptable to different light conditions, able to flourish in both bright and indirect light.

This adaptability makes them perfect for any indoor space, whether it's a sun-soaked windowsill or a dim corner. Plus, they're less prone to pests and diseases compared to other houseplants, reducing the time and effort you'd spend on maintenance.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can Cacti Thrive in Low-Light Conditions Indoors?

Yes, cacti can thrive in low-light conditions, but they prefer bright, indirect light. If you place them near a window or use grow lights, you'll encourage healthy growth and vibrant colors in your indoor space.

What Types of Cacti Are Best for Beginners?

If you're starting out, consider easy-care options like the Golden Barrel or the Bunny Ear cactus. They're resilient, require minimal watering, and adapt well to indoor settings, making them perfect for beginners like you.

Do Cacti Attract Pests or Insects Indoors?

Cacti can attract pests like mealybugs or spider mites, but they're generally low-maintenance. Keep an eye on your plants, and you'll spot any issues early, ensuring a healthy environment for everyone around you.

How Often Should I Water My Indoor Cacti?

You should water your indoor cacti every two to three weeks, allowing the soil to dry out completely between watering. Keep an eye on their appearance; they'll signal when they need more moisture.
